    The classic pisco sour recipe contains pisco brandy (usually an un-aged grape brandy from Perú), fresh lime juice, fresh lemon juice, simple syrup, egg white, and bitters. [3] It is shaken , strained , and served straight in a cocktail glass then garnished with the bitters (cinnamon can be used).
